Psychodelics are known non-addictive. And they have shown remarkable results in clinical tests. It's an absolute outrage that they were outlawed in the 60s after so much mainstream, promising research.
They're coming back, though. I think 20-40 years from now, we'll have a kindler, gentler nation because they will be used by the medical profession. shite, just for our military personnel returning home, I hope this happens.
I know of 3 legal facilities - one in the Netherlands, one in Mexico and one in Jamaica. The guy in Jamaica is actually from Kentucky and has a podcast that is worth listening to.
MycoMeditations
He hosts week long retreats with 3 trips over the 7 days. They have facilitators on hand to help. It is not supposed to be "fun" - although one would hope there are pleasurable aspects. It should be considered "work" - work on the self and on well being. They also give very high base doses. Most people on here saying they've "done shrooms", probably had 2 grams at most. This guy starts around 5 grams per trip - and some people do up to 15. The difference is the set and setting. It's all very responsibly curated.
Listen to the podcast - it's just him talking to retreat guests post-trip.
